-
Notifications
You must be signed in to change notification settings - Fork 3
Забележки по формата за протоколи #27
Copy link
Copy link
Open
Labels
Description
Когато ми се наложи да тествам тази форма се побърках. При най-малката грешка попълвам едни и същи данни постоянно със странни widget-и.
- Widget-а за часа е отвратително неудобен. Има AM/PM!? Django има widget за това.
- Widget-а за датата не му отстъпва с много. Без да искам попълних 0014-та година. След това не е лесно да се върне човек, а като избера дата той не се скрива, докато не натисна странен бутон с точица. Освен това изглежда зле. Django има widget и за това.
- Полетата за присъстващи, ако не се попълнят гърмят със странна грешка от типа "това поле не може да е -1"
Всяко едно от горепосочените полета + още няколко си губят данните при изпращане и наличие на грешка. Представи си следния use case. Има събрание, на което трябва да присъстват 60 души, но 18 от тях липсват и едва 4-ма са освободени. Представи си как ги попълваш веднъж, забравяш да попълнеш едно от много други полета и те накара да ги вкараш от ново.
Reactions are currently unavailable